Unfortunately, this is not allowed as a deduction on your taxes.  It is considered a gift to your mother.

If you are asking if it is considered to be part of "support" for being a dependent, then yes, it is part of support.

Support includes:

  • Food
  • Lodging expenses
  • Clothing
  • Education (including the GI bill)
  • Medical and dental care (including insurance and supplementary Medicare premiums)
  • Recreation
  • Transportation and similar necessities

Support does not include:

  • Life insurance premiums
  • Funeral expenses
  • Federal, state, or local income taxes or Social Security and Medicare taxes paid on a person's own income
  • Scholarship grants
  • Income made by a disabled person in a sheltered workshop
